Sulfur dioxide or sulphur dioxide is the compound with the formula SO2. It's a toxic gas liable for the smell of burnt matches. It's released naturally by volcanic activity and is produced as a by-product of copper extraction and therefore the burning of fossil fuels contaminated with sulfur compounds.
Complete answer:
When sulfur dioxide is dissolved in water it forms sulphurous acid.
SO2+H2O→H2SO3

Sulphur dioxide affects the systema respiratorium, particularly lung function, and may irritate the eyes. Sulphur dioxide irritates the tract and increases the danger of tract infections. It causes coughing, mucus secretion and aggravates conditions like asthma and bronchitis.
